An AI coding bootcamp promises a faster route into artificial intelligence. In a matter of weeks or months, you’re taught the tools, workflows, and concepts used in real AI roles. For some people, that structure is exactly what they need. For others, it’s an expensive detour.

This guide explains what an AI coding bootcamp actually teaches, who benefits most from enrolling, and how to decide whether a bootcamp is the right move for you. If you’re trying to learn AI efficiently, without wasting time or money, this context matters more than any marketing page.

Quick answer: An AI coding bootcamp can accelerate your entry into artificial intelligence, but only at the right moment. Most programs run 8 to 24 weeks, cost between $3,500 and $16,000, and teach applied skills rather than deep theory. Whether it’s worth it depends entirely on where you are, what you want, and whether the structure a bootcamp provides is something you actually need.


What Is an AI Coding Bootcamp?

An AI coding bootcamp is an intensive, short-term program focused on applied artificial intelligence skills. Most programs run between 8 and 24 weeks and prioritise practical outcomes over theory.

Unlike a computer science degree, an AI coding bootcamp doesn’t aim to make you an expert. The goal is narrower: to help you become capable enough to work on real projects, understand AI workflows, and contribute in junior or adjacent AI roles.

Bootcamps sit somewhere between traditional software engineering bootcamps and academic machine learning programs. They’re designed for speed, not depth. That distinction matters more than most program websites will tell you.


What Most AI Coding Bootcamps Actually Teach

While curricula vary, most AI coding bootcamps cover a similar core foundation.

Programming for AI. Python is almost always the primary language. You’ll learn how to read and write code with a focus on data handling, model training, and experimentation rather than software architecture.

Machine learning fundamentals. This typically includes supervised vs unsupervised learning, regression and classification models, and basic model evaluation. You’re taught how to apply models long before you’re expected to deeply understand the math behind them.

Popular AI libraries. Most programs introduce NumPy and pandas for data manipulation, scikit-learn for machine learning, and TensorFlow or PyTorch for basic deep learning. The emphasis is on usage, not building algorithms from scratch.

Portfolio projects. Nearly every AI coding bootcamp ends with one or more projects. For many students, these are the most valuable outcome because they demonstrate applied skill rather than theoretical knowledge. When you’re job hunting, a portfolio project is evidence. A certificate alone is not.


What AI Coding Bootcamps Usually Don’t Teach Well

It’s just as important to know what bootcamps don’t cover. Most AI coding bootcamps do not teach advanced mathematics in depth, prepare you for research or PhD-level AI roles, spend meaningful time on long-term AI ethics and governance, or make you competitive for senior ML engineering positions.

The distinction matters: some bootcamps teach you how to use AI tools, while others teach you how to build AI systems. The skills are different, the career paths are different, and choosing the wrong type means wasting time and money. Career Contessa

If you expect a bootcamp to replace years of experience or a full degree, the reality will likely disappoint. Used strategically at the right moment, a bootcamp can build genuine momentum. Used too early or with misaligned expectations, it’s an expensive distraction.


Three Established AI Coding Bootcamps Worth Knowing

These are well-known providers with consistent reputations. This is context, not endorsement.

General Assembly offers data science and machine learning programs that overlap heavily with AI skills. Their strength lies in structure, instructor support, and career-focused delivery. General Assembly has partnerships with thousands of companies worldwide, and their career support starts from day one rather than after you finish the program. Chicago Sun-Times Best suited for people transitioning from non-technical backgrounds into junior technical roles.

Springboard runs AI and machine learning tracks that are mentor-led and flexible, often chosen by career switchers who want guided accountability without a full-time schedule. Springboard’s ML Engineering and AI Bootcamp runs online over nine months and combines structured coursework with heavy project work, finishing with a capstone that takes you from prototype to production. Career Contessa Their programs emphasise projects and one-on-one mentorship.

Flatiron School provides immersive programs in software engineering and data science with AI-relevant pathways. Their approach is intensive and best suited for learners who thrive under pressure and structure.

All three prioritise applied learning over theory. None replace long-term experience.


AI Coding Bootcamp vs Self-Study: Which One Is Right for You

AI Coding BootcampSelf-Study
Cost$3,500 to $16,000Free to low cost
StructureDeadlines, cohorts, mentorsEntirely self-directed
PacingFixed scheduleFlexible
ProjectsGuided and often pre-scopedYou define them
Best forPeople who need accountabilitySelf-directed learners

An AI coding bootcamp offers deadlines and accountability, a curated curriculum, mentor and peer support, and faster exposure to real projects. Self-study offers lower cost, flexible pacing, deeper focus on fundamentals, and the freedom to explore before committing.

Many successful learners combine both: self-study first, bootcamp later, once they understand what kind of AI work they actually enjoy. Jumping into a bootcamp before you know which direction interests you is one of the most common and expensive mistakes in this space.


Do You Actually Need an AI Coding Bootcamp to Get Into AI?

No. Many people get into AI through online courses, internal role transitions, data or analytics roles, and gradual project-based learning.

An AI coding bootcamp is one path, not a requirement. It works best when used intentionally, not reactively. The people who get the most from bootcamps tend to share a few characteristics: they already have some direction about which type of AI work interests them, they’ve tried self-study and found they need external structure to stay accountable, and they have the financial cushion to invest without pressure to take the first job that comes along after graduating.

If any of those conditions aren’t in place yet, a bootcamp is likely premature.


How to Decide If an AI Coding Bootcamp Is Worth It

Before enrolling, ask the program directly: what does the typical graduate background look like? Are the portfolio projects realistic or heavily guided? Who teaches the course and what is their current industry experience? What does job support actually consist of, and can they show you concrete placement data?

Be cautious of guaranteed salary claims, inflated placement statistics, and any pressure-based enrollment tactics. Because bootcamp content is often pre-recorded and can scale to thousands of students, prices are lower but you’re mostly learning alone, without personal mentorship, code reviews, or career coaching. Career Contessa Knowing which model you’re signing up for matters before you hand over thousands of dollars.

A good AI coding bootcamp should be transparent about who it’s not for. If the sales conversation is all about outcomes and never about fit, that’s a signal worth taking seriously.


The Bottom Line on AI Coding Bootcamps

An AI coding bootcamp can accelerate learning at the right moment, but it’s not a shortcut to mastery. Used too early, it can feel overwhelming and expensive. Used strategically, it can build confidence, structure, and momentum.

If you’re still figuring out how AI works or which direction interests you, start smaller. Build foundations. Experiment with free tools and courses. Once you understand your direction, deciding whether a bootcamp makes sense becomes much easier, and you’ll be a better student when you do enrol.

Learning AI is a long game. The best path is the one that keeps you progressing consistently, not the one that promises the fastest result.
